Management of Hyperlipasemia (Lipase 51 U/L)
Initial Clinical Assessment
A lipase level of 51 U/L is minimally elevated and does not require specific intervention unless accompanied by characteristic abdominal pain or imaging findings consistent with acute pancreatitis. 1
The diagnosis of acute pancreatitis requires lipase levels at least 3 times the upper limit of normal (ULN), not just any elevation above the reference range. 1, 2, 3 A lipase of 51 U/L (assuming ULN ~40-60 U/L) represents only a mild elevation that is clinically insignificant in isolation.
Diagnostic Approach for Mild Lipase Elevation
When to Pursue Further Workup
No further pancreatic-specific evaluation is needed if the patient lacks abdominal pain, nausea, vomiting, or other symptoms suggestive of pancreatitis. 1, 4
Serial lipase measurements every 6 hours should only be performed if there is clinical concern for evolving pancreatitis or if the patient develops symptoms. 4
Imaging studies (ultrasound or CT) are not indicated for lipase levels <3× ULN in asymptomatic patients. 4, 3
Common Non-Pancreatic Causes to Consider
Even at this mild elevation, consider alternative etiologies:
Renal insufficiency is the most common cause of non-pancreatic hyperlipasemia, as lipase is cleared renally. 2, 5, 6
Medications, particularly tyrosine kinase inhibitors and immune checkpoint inhibitors, can cause asymptomatic lipase elevation. 4
Gastrointestinal conditions including inflammatory bowel disease, bowel obstruction, and acute cholecystitis may cause mild lipase elevation. 4, 5
Hepatic dysfunction and decompensated cirrhosis are associated with elevated lipase without pancreatitis. 2, 6
Management Algorithm
For Asymptomatic Patients with Lipase 51 U/L:
Review medication list for potential causative agents (TKIs, checkpoint inhibitors). 4
Check renal function (creatinine, eGFR) as reduced clearance is the leading cause of isolated lipase elevation. 2, 5, 6
No dietary restrictions are necessary—the patient can maintain normal oral intake. 1
No specific treatment is required for the lipase elevation itself. 1
Repeat lipase only if symptoms develop (abdominal pain, nausea, vomiting, anorexia). 4
If Symptoms Develop:
Obtain imaging (abdominal ultrasound first-line) if lipase rises to >3× ULN or if clinical suspicion for pancreatitis is high. 4
The optimal diagnostic cutoff for acute pancreatitis in critically ill patients is lipase ≥532 U/L, with sensitivity 77.4% and specificity 78.0%. 3
In general populations, lipase ≥666 U/L provides better discrimination (sensitivity 71.4%, specificity 88.8%) between pancreatitis and non-pancreatic causes. 6
Critical Pitfalls to Avoid
Do not diagnose acute pancreatitis based on mild lipase elevation alone—this leads to unnecessary imaging, dietary restrictions, and hospitalization. 1, 2, 3
Normal amylase does not exclude pancreatic pathology if clinical suspicion is high, but at this lipase level, pancreatitis is extremely unlikely. 4
The degree of enzyme elevation does not correlate with pancreatitis severity—once the diagnosis is established, lipase levels should not guide management decisions. 4
Non-pancreatic hyperlipasemia (NPHL) is associated with higher mortality than acute pancreatitis (22.4% vs 5.1%), but this reflects the severity of underlying conditions (sepsis, AKI) rather than the lipase elevation itself. 6
Elevated neutrophil-to-lymphocyte ratio (>10.37) is a stronger predictor of adverse outcomes in NPHL than the lipase level itself. 6
